Microwave heating can create local thermal runaways in some materials with reduced thermal conductivity which also have dielectric constants that raise with temperature level. An instance is glass, which can show thermal runaway in a microwave oven to the point of melting if preheated. Additionally, microwaves can thaw specific kinds of rocks, producing small amounts of liquified rock. Some porcelains can likewise be thawed, as well as might even come to be clear upon air conditioning. Thermal runaway is more normal of electrically conductive fluids such as salted water. Cooking equipment utilized in a microwave is usually much cooler than the food because the kitchenware is clear to microwaves; the microwaves heat the food directly and the pots and pans is indirectly warmed by the food. Food as well as cooking equipment from a conventional oven, on the other hand, are the same temperature as the rest of the oven; a normal food preparation temperature level is 180 ° C (356 ° F). That implies that standard stoves and ovens can cause much more major burns. Microwave ovens have a minimal duty in professional food preparation, because the boiling-range temperatures of a microwave will certainly not generate the savory chemical reactions that frying, browning, or cooking at a higher temperature level will. Like various other heating approaches, microwaving converts vitamin B12 from an energetic to non-active form; the amount of conversion depends upon the temperature got to, as well as the cooking time. Steamed food gets to an optimum of 100 ° C (212 ° F), whereas microwaved food can get inside hotter than this, causing quicker break down of vitamin B12. The greater price of loss is partly offset by the shorter food preparation times required. Water and also other uniform fluids can superheat when warmed in a microwave oven in a container with a smooth surface area. That is, the fluid reaches a temperature level somewhat over its normal boiling point without bubbles of vapour forming inside the fluid. The boiling procedure can begin explosively when the fluid is interrupted, such as when the user grabs the container to remove it from the oven or while adding strong active ingredients such as powdered creamer or sugar. This can result in spontaneous boiling which may be violent enough to expel the boiling fluid from the container and also create extreme scalding.
